Spinal cord injuries are dismayingly common. More than one million people in the United States are paralyzed from them. More than half of spinal cord injuries in America result from car accidents or gunshot wounds, so, as you might expect, men are four times more likely to get a spinal cord injury than women. They are especially susceptible between the ages of sixteen and thirty— Bryson, Bill. The Body (p. 310). Knopf Doubleday Publishing Group. Kindle Edition.
